Actor and comedian Robo Shankar passed away at the age of 46. The actor, who was undergoing treatment at a private hospital in Chennai for a complex abdominal condition, breathed his last.
Dhanush arrives at residence
The actor's body has been kept at his residence for fans, friends and colleagues from the film industry to pay their last respects.
As per a report by IANS, the Tamil star arrived at the late actor's residence.
The report mentioned that Dhanush was seen consoling his family members, who were in shock and grieving their loss.
Udhayanidhi Stalin shares his tribute
Multiple celebrities and politicians have been sharing their respects. Tamil Nadu Deputy Chief Minister and actor-producer Udhayanidhi Stalin was also present at the late actor's residence to pay his last tributes. On his social media handle, he wrote, "I was deeply saddened to hear the news of the passing away of actor Robo Shankar.".
He also extended his condolences not only to the actor's family but also to his friends, colleagues, and countless fans.
Kamal Haasan on X
Tamil veteran Kamal Haasan on social media also wrote, "Robo Shankar Robo is just a pseudonym. In my dictionary, you are a human. Therefore, my younger brother. So, will you just leave me and go? You left, your job is done. My job remains unfinished. You leave tomorrow for us. Therefore, tomorrow is ours."
His funeral rites will be taking place on this day, September 19, in the afternoon.Robo Shankar is survived by his wife Priyanka and daughter Indraja.Robo Shankar has shared the screen with multiple stars in his career in the Tamil film industry. He has worked with Dhanush, Vishal, Vishnu Vishal and others.
